The original Hot or otherwise not, which launched in 2000, was actually the precursor to this ranks apps—a web site that let strangers evaluate pulchritude by profile photo alone. It really is very outdated, tag Zuckerberg cheated the idea to have Facebook rolling. So just how did the newly relaunched variation reach no. 13 in fruit’s application shop? By using good old mail junk e-mail.

Based on its internet site and iTunes page, the fresh new Hot or otherwise not premiered by or otherwise not restricted. The firm boasts a perks-packed London company in the middle of Soho and also started providing apple’s ios designers ВЈ1,000 as an added bonus due to their work present, regardless if they ignore the task. Although corporate path in fact stops with Badoo, the enigmatic, spammy online dating providers owned by Russian business person Andrey Andreev, who had been when known as “one of the very mysterious entrepreneurs into the West.”

In April 2012, Badoo brokered a “white-label price” to “effectively powering Hot or otherwise not’s service on their behalf,” that would assist get Badoo to the U.S. markets.

Hot or perhaps not’s unexpected iOS success puts they ahead of fb (no. 15), Candy Crush (no. 17), and never that much behind Snapchat (no. 6). Tinder is all the way in which down at no. 108. That’s difficult because when you look at their unique interfaces side-by-side they are nearly alike. You’ll find the “heart” and “X” icons to suggest interest, just how photos become framed to appear like polaroids, in addition to a messaging features. Both programs in addition make use of myspace to log-in and automatically populate your own visibility with photo.

Upgrade: around sunday, Valleywag obtained a response from Hot or perhaps not through Michelle Kennedy, that has been being employed as manager of appropriate and business affairs for Badoo from 2011 till the provide, in accordance with this LinkedIn profile.

Kennedy said that the reason why Hot or otherwise not might climbing the application store are “definitely perhaps not from spamming.” Valleywag might getting e-mail about girls “liking” the images because a Hot or Not account was going using tips@valleywag.com email address on April 7, 2006:

“so that it had been a portion of the earliest Hot or otherwise not databases (which we later on acquired). The e-mails delivered to this accounts just weren’t unsolicited-they are emails delivered to a registered user regarding the Hot or Not provider.”

She in addition attempted to give an explanation for relationship between Hot or Not and Badoo, although it’s however unclear in my experience:

Whilst precisely mention, Hot or otherwise not used to be white labelled by Badoo.

However, after requirements from Hot or Not people for the solution to go back to it really is initial style, your decision was made for Hot or otherwise not become hived faraway from Badoo, and a small grouping of imaginative minds chose to develop Hot or perhaps not for 2014.

Responding to follow-up concerns, Kennedy stated the reason why that e-mail from Hot or perhaps not however state Badoo restricted since it is:

“a hangover from Badoo days since it was actually utilizing a Badoo template-thank your for drawing they to your focus, i’ll bring that up-to-date asap.”

I also expected Kennedy to explain just what she implied by “hive off”

By Hive Off, i am talking about that a group of anyone, newer and more effective, some Badooers are working on Hot or perhaps not (as another venture from Badoo), nevertheless attracting on some the brains of Badoo for information. We decided to hive-off Hot or perhaps not (as I talked about, responding to individual demand for the return of older goods, following the white tag) in the past one-fourth of last year

About the similarities between Tinder and Hot or perhaps not’s recently relaunched cellular software, Kennedy stated:

As you point out in your post, Hot or otherwise not is doing its thing permanently. It even prompted FB. In reality, probably you have observed, many posts reference Tinder as a version of Hot or Not, so I think the question really should end up being the more method?

But as you can tell from whilst far back as December, 2012, this what Hot or Not’s internet site looked like, a rather janky classic sense. The cellular app looks a lot more like Tinder, which founded in September 2012.
